
Brevo (Sendinblue) Email
Verification Integration
Connect your Brevo account to ValidEmailChecker and verify your contact lists without exporting a single file. Paste your API key, select a list, and start cleaning — protecting your sender score and keeping your bounce rates low across email, SMS, and CRM.

Connect Brevo (Sendinblue)
Enter your API key to get started
Connection Name
Brevo API Key
Where to find:Settings → SMTP & API → API keys & MCP → Generate new API key
What You Need to Get Started
Brevo Account
Free or paid plan.
API Key
Settings → SMTP & API → API keys & MCP.
Verification Credits
1 credit per email verified.
60 Seconds
Paste your key and you are connected.
How to Connect Brevo
One API key, three clicks, and you are verifying.
Generate Your API Key
Log into your Brevo account and click your account name in the top-right corner. Select Settings, then navigate to SMTP & API in the left sidebar under Organization settings. Click the API keys & MCP tab, then click Generate a new API key. Give it a name like "Valid Email Checker Integration" and click Generate.
Important: Brevo only shows your API key once when you create it. Copy it immediately and store it somewhere safe. If you lose it, you will need to generate a new one.
Connect Your Account
In ValidEmailChecker, go to Integrations and click + Connect Integration. Select Sendinblue (Brevo), enter a friendly connection name like "Main Brevo Account," paste your API Key, and click Connect Account. We validate your key instantly and pull in your available lists.
Select a List and Configure
Once connected, you will see all your Brevo lists with contact counts. Select the list you want to verify, then choose Verify Only to review results without changes, or Clean Automatically to remove invalid and disposable emails directly from Brevo. You control what happens to each email type — unsubscribe, delete, or keep.
Tip:"Delete" is permanent in Brevo and cannot be undone. Start with "Verify Only" on your first run, or choose "Unsubscribe" to preserve contacts while preventing them from receiving emails.
Track Results in Real Time
Click Import Listand you will be redirected to the Uploads & Results page. Progress updates automatically — no refreshing needed. When complete, you get a full breakdown of safe, invalid, risky, disposable, catch-all, and more. If you chose automatic cleaning, changes are already applied to your Brevo list.
Want a visual walkthrough with screenshots?
Our help center has the full guide with images for every screen.
Two Ways to Verify
Verify Only
Import and verify without modifying anything in Brevo. Review results and decide what to do next.
Best for:
Clean Automatically Recommended
Verify and clean in one step. Invalid emails get unsubscribed or deleted directly from Brevo.
Actions available:
Tracking Your Verification Progress
Everything updates in real time on the Uploads & Results page.
Processing
Verification in progress
Completed
Click "View Results" for breakdown
With Warning
Some emails could not be processed
Failed
Something went wrong (rare)
Managing Your Brevo Connection
Connection Actions
Click the three-dot menu next to any connection:
Sync Now
Refresh lists and contact counts from Brevo.
Rename
Change the connection display name.
Delete
Remove connection. Does not affect your Brevo account.
Updating your API key? If you revoke or regenerate your key in Brevo, delete the existing connection in ValidEmailChecker and create a new one with the new key.
Multiple Accounts
Managing multiple Brevo accounts? Connect as many as you need.
Go to Bulk Upload → Connect Email Platform → Sendinblue (Brevo)
Click "+ Add Another Account" in the connection picker
Enter the API key for the new account
Give it a unique name to tell them apart
Example names: "Brevo — Main Account," "Brevo — Client ABC," "Brevo — Newsletter." Each connection must have a unique name.
Credits & Billing
1 Credit = 1 Email
Same rate as all other methods.
Unknown = Refunded
Credits returned for unverifiable emails.
Duplicates = Free
Removed before charging.
Connecting = Free
Syncing never uses credits.
Brevo Tips
Sendinblue to Brevo
Sendinblue rebranded to Brevo in 2023. The platform is the same — just a fresh name and look. You may still see "Sendinblue" in parts of the interface, and that is perfectly normal. Your existing account works as-is.
Unsubscribe vs Delete
List Count Differences
Contact counts may differ slightly from Brevo due to recent additions not yet synced, duplicate deduplication, or blocklisted and unsubscribed contacts. Use Sync Now to refresh the latest counts.
Troubleshooting
"Invalid API Key" Error
Make sure you copied the full API key without missing characters. Check that the key has not been deleted or revoked in Brevo. Go to Settings → SMTP & API → API keys & MCP and generate a new key if needed.
No Lists Appearing
Log into Brevo and check Contacts → Lists to ensure you have at least one list with contacts. Verify your API key has the correct permissions. Click Sync Now in ValidEmailChecker to refresh.
Connection Works But Import Fails
Check your ValidEmailChecker credit balance — you need enough credits for the list size. Verify the list has contacts in Brevo. For very large lists, try during off-peak hours.
List Count Does Not Match Brevo
Contact counts may differ due to recent additions not yet synced, duplicate deduplication, or blocklisted contacts. Click Sync Now to refresh the latest counts from Brevo.
Best Practices
Before Your First Run
Ongoing Hygiene
Recommended Actions
Frequently Asked Questions
Only if you choose "Clean list automatically." With "Verify only," we just read and verify — no changes are made to your Brevo account whatsoever.
Yes. Sendinblue rebranded to Brevo in 2023 — the platform is the same. Your existing Sendinblue account works perfectly with this integration. You may still see "Sendinblue" in parts of the interface, and that is completely normal.
No. Connecting and syncing your Brevo account is completely free. You only use credits when you actually verify emails — 1 credit per email, same as every other verification method.
Yes. Connect as many accounts as you need — one for each brand, client, or team. Each gets its own named connection so you can tell them apart in the dashboard. Each connection needs a unique name.
Contacts are permanently removed from your Brevo list. They will not appear in that list anymore and cannot be recovered through ValidEmailChecker. If you are unsure, use "Unsubscribe" instead — it preserves the contact but prevents them from receiving emails.
Yes. After verification completes, you can download results in CSV, XLSX, JSON, or TXT format from the Uploads and Results page.
Currently, you verify one list at a time. This gives you more control and lets you prioritize your most important lists first. You can verify multiple lists back-to-back without reconnecting.
Ready to Clean Your Brevo Lists?
Sign up, paste your API key, and verify your first list in under two minutes. 200 free credits included — no credit card required.
Get Started Free200 free credits · No credit card · Results in minutes
